PADDLE steamer Waverley is returning to Weymouth this month.
It will be taking passengers on excursions along the Dorset coast and beyond from Wednesday, September 9 to Wednesday, September 23.
Waverley is the the world's last sea-going paddle steamer and this year marks the 40th year that the ship has sailed in preservation.
Sold for £1, the vessel has been operated by a charity since 1975, and preserved as a heritage asset for the benefit of the communities around the UK.
Captain Andy O’Brian, Waverley’s captain, said: “Paddle Steamer Waverley offers the chance to view parts of our unique coastline from a different perspective."
